In the fast-paced world of mobile, wedding, and club DJing, time is the most valuable commodity. Dance floors are fickle, and a track with a sluggish two-minute intro or an overextended outro can drain the energy from a room in seconds. This paper explores the Mastermix DJ Edits Collection as a significant cultural artifact within the history of dance music and DJ culture. While often dismissed as utilitarian tools for working DJs, the compilation represents a specific evolution in the practice of the "edit"—the modification of existing recordings to suit the logistic and kinetic needs of the dancefloor. By analyzing the functional intent, aesthetic characteristics, and legal ambiguities of the Mastermix series, this study argues that these edits function as a form of vernacular audio engineering, democratizing complex production techniques and preserving the "remix" culture of the disco and house eras for contemporary audiences.
